As featured in the "Best Beauty Buys" in the April 2006 InStyle! British made. Oval shaped brush with natural bristle and nylon pins set in soft rubber air cushion base. Ideal for grooming and dressing medium length, fine to normal hair. The bristle will polish and condition the hair while gently stimulating the scalp.

British Hairdresser of the year 1993 & 1997 Special Features: - Air-cushioned rubber pad
- Ergonomic handle design
- Resistant to heat
Benefits: - Gentle control
- Snag-free grooming
- Comfort during use
- Hygienic and durable
Brush Care: - Regularly remove loose hairs with a comb
- Wash occasionally in warm water ensuring that the air hole is covered
- Rinse and leave to dry away from direct heat and sunlight
